How do I know if my windscreen can be repaired or needs replacement?
Generally, if the damage is smaller sized than a quarter and situated far from the driver's view, repair is possible. Consulting a certified technician is important.
2. How long does a glass repair take?
The majority of minor repairs can be completed within 30 to 60 minutes, while full replacements may take a couple of hours, depending on the provider's work.
3. Will my insurance cover the glass repair?
Many insurance coverage consist of coverage for glass damage. Examine your specific policy or call your insurance representative for more information.
4. How can I pick a reliable glass repair service?
Try to find consumer reviews, request recommendations, look for correct licensing and certifications, and ask about warranties on repairs.
5. Are mobile glass repair services worth it?
Absolutely! Mobile services provide the benefit of repairs at your place and typically save you time and trouble.
